Red de conocimiento informático - Problemas con los teléfonos móviles - Si el lenguaje Python ingresa una letra y es una letra minúscula en inglés, ¿se convertirá a la letra mayúscula correspondiente y se generará?

Si el lenguaje Python ingresa una letra y es una letra minúscula en inglés, ¿se convertirá a la letra mayúscula correspondiente y se generará?

Conclusión: En Python, podemos implementar fácilmente la función de convertir letras minúsculas inglesas ingresadas por el usuario en letras mayúsculas. Los siguientes son ejemplos de dos métodos:

Primero, obtenga las letras minúsculas ingresadas por el usuario a través de la función input() de Python y luego use declaraciones condicionales para determinar si están dentro del rango ASCII desde 'a'. a 'z'. Si se cumplen las condiciones, utilice la función Upper() para convertirlo a mayúsculas y generar:

char1=input("Ingrese una letra minúscula en inglés:");

iford (char1) >=ord('a')andord(char1)

print(char1.upper());

else:

print(" ¡No es una letra minúscula!");

Otro método es usar código de estilo C/C++, obtener información a través de scanf() y luego usar operadores de caracteres para realizar la conversión de mayúsculas y minúsculas:

#include

intmain(){

chara;

printf("Ingrese un carácter: ");

scanf(" %c ",&a);

if(a>='a'&&a

a=a+32;//Convierte letras minúsculas a mayúsculas

}

printf("La letra minúscula de este carácter es: %c\n",a);

}

Ambos métodos pueden alcanzar el tamaño de letras Para escribir conversiones, la versión Python es más concisa y la versión C/C++ muestra operaciones similares en diferentes lenguajes de programación.